| Specification | Detail | |---------------|--------| | Max supported resolution | 2048 x 1152 @ 60Hz | | Input interfaces | DVI-D, HDMI 1.4, CVBS (optional) | | Control interface | USB 2.0 Type-B, 100M Ethernet | | Output ports | 4 x RJ45 (Gigabit, custom protocol) | | Max load capacity | 1,048,576 pixels per port | | Operating temperature | -20°C to +70°C | | Power supply | 12V DC, 3A (peak) | | Firmware | Upgradeable via USB |

This controller was designed to drive LED modules, allowing business owners to program moving text, simple graphics, or time/temperature data onto illuminated signs. Aboled sc-ds-d 2014-i kontroller

First introduced in the 2014 hardware revision cycle, the SC-DS-D 2014-I model represents a specific generation of Aboled’s synchronous control technology. Despite the emergence of newer 5G and Wi-Fi-enabled controllers, this unit remains widely deployed in stadiums, transportation hubs, and outdoor advertising networks.
